In programming, the "current directory" (also called the "working directory") is the folder from which an executable is running. When a keygen or patch tries to write a modified binary or a license file, it attempts to save that data to its own location.
Why it fails: UAC prevents writing inside protected folders (Program Files, Windows, System32).
